Q159779: WD97: Invalid Page Fault Opening File with Long Path, File Name

SYMPTOMS
========

Case 1
------

When you attempt to open a document by double-clicking the file in Windows
Explorer, the following error message appears:

  This program has performed an illegal operation and will be shut down. If the
  problem persists, contact the program vendor.

When you click Details, one of the following error messages appears:

- 

  Winword caused an invalid page fault in module <unknown> at
  0000:<address>.

  -or-

- 

  Winword caused an invalid page fault in module Mso97.dll at
  0137:<address>.

Case 2
------

When you attempt to open a document by double-clicking the file in the Open
dialog box in Word, the file does not open, and no error messages are given.

CAUSE
=====

This problem occurs when the document file name or the path and file name exceed
223 characters.

WORKAROUND
==========

Work around the problems in the cases above by using the appropriate method:

- Start Word and then open the document.

  -or-

- Shorten the file name.

  -or-

- Shorten the path to the document or move the document to a higher-level
  folder.
